Output 70e851e66503879ed7b9097eb45552c46ca2dc324c597360b2163a6955c4ac47:2114

value
625910
script pubkey
OP_0 OP_PUSHBYTES_20 ddf9bc751bd1a17032d8743b7529cb273466bf60
address
bc1qmhumcagm6xshqvkcwsah22wtyu6xd0mqk5d3f4
transaction
70e851e66503879ed7b9097eb45552c46ca2dc324c597360b2163a6955c4ac47
confirmations
243681
spent
true